Under Alien Skies – Environment, Suffering, and the Defeat of the British Military in Revolutionary America

Size : 6.7 MB | English | 2025 | EPUB
Under Alien Skies – Environment, Suffering, and the Defeat of the British Military in Revolutionary America
Size : 6.7 MB | English | 2025 | EPUB